Output 3aabf6fcb717cf6069e893bea362beb4c2c2507f8a01c84ed840cfd99e329e53:19

value
81687
script pubkey
OP_0 OP_PUSHBYTES_20 1d4c39c6902a3f26eb53a6a14b5a72fe04be7512
address
bc1qr4xrn35s9gljd66n56s5kknjlcztuagj5stdql
transaction
3aabf6fcb717cf6069e893bea362beb4c2c2507f8a01c84ed840cfd99e329e53
spent
true